While writing footnotes, I sometimes reffer in one footnote to another
footnote. If I add or delete a footnote above the one being reffered to, how
do I get the number of the reffered footnote to change automatically within
the reffering footnote? I tried hyperlinking, but I can't have the
hyperlinked text be the footnote number.
 
S

Suzanne S. Barnhill

Insert | Reference | Cross-reference: Footnote: Footnote number.

Suzanne said:
Insert | Reference | Cross-reference: Footnote: Footnote number.

and note that while footnotes will update immediately as you insert a
new footnote, you will need to Update Fields to update the
cross-references (select all, hit F9 to update fields).
